Report on Genetic Engineering

Genetic engineering has been a hotly debated topic in politics as well as society in the past decades and still is today. Arguments like the nutrition of a growing world population due to a declining infant mortality rate or the loss of considerable areas of arable land due to erosion or pollution damage keep fueling the controversy whether genetically modified organisms (GMO), especially crops, are needed to sustain the global demand for food. On the opposite, concerns have been raised concerning the potential adverse effects on human health and environmental safety. Besides the facts, part of the public dispute is based around ethical questions and trust issues towards institutions and authorities. There have been studies and surveys carried out addressing many of these topics. Additionally a diverse cluster of organisations and the media is bombarding the public with contrary statements. This report tries to give an overview on mankind's relation towards modifying genetics, a brief summary of used methods, and gathers statements from scientists and authorities. It is meant as the motivational basis for this years Marburg iGEM team´s Public Engagement and Human Practice efforts.
